The Factory Finish Process The procedure of using a factory finish to a composite door is a multi-step treatment that includes precision and know-how. Here are the crucial phases:
- Preparation:
- Surface Cleaning: The door is completely cleaned up to remove any dust, particles, or pollutants that might interfere with the finish. Surface Conditioning: The surface is conditioned to guarantee that the finish adheres effectively. This may involve sanding or using a guide. Base Coat Application:
- Primer: A guide is applied to produce a smooth, even surface area and to improve the adhesion of the overcoat. Skim coat: The base coat is applied, which can be a solid color or a wood grain pattern, depending on the desired aesthetic. Leading Coat Application:
- Top Coat: A resilient leading coat is used to provide the last layer of protection and to attain the preferred finish (e.g., matte, semi-gloss, or gloss). Treating: The door is enabled to cure in a controlled environment to make sure that the finish sets effectively. Quality Control:
- Inspection: The finished door is inspected for any defects, such as bubbles, scratches, or uneven application. Last Touches: Any required touch-ups are made to ensure a flawless finish. Products Used in Factory Finishing The materials utilized in the factory finish of composite doors are carefully selected to make sure sturdiness and efficiency. Typical materials consist of:
- Acrylic Resins: These supply exceptional adhesion and resistance to UV rays. Polyurethane: Known for its durability and versatility, polyurethane is typically used in top coats to provide a durable, lasting finish. Solvent-Based Finishes: These are known for their quick drying times and high gloss surfaces. Water-Based Finishes: These are environmentally friendly and provide a variety of surfaces from matte to high gloss. FAQs About Composite Door Factory Finish Q: How long does a factory finish last?A: A properly applied factory finish can last for 20 years or more, depending upon the quality of the materials and the care of the door.
- Q: Can a factory finish be repaired if it gets damaged?A: Yes, minor damage can typically be fixed by applying touch-up paint or a repair package. However, for more considerable damage, it might be required to refinish the entire door.
- Q: Are factory surfaces more expensive than DIY finishes?A: Generally, factory surfaces are more pricey due to the top quality products and controlled application procedure. However, they provide exceptional toughness and a professional finish, which can be more cost-effective in the long run.
- Q: Can composite doors be painted after setup?A: While it is possible to paint composite doors after installation, it is generally not advised. The factory finish is created to be extremely durable and resistant to the elements, and painting over it can jeopardize its integrity.
- Q: What is the very best way to maintain a factory-finished composite door?A: Regular cleansing with a moderate cleaning agent and water is usually sufficient to preserve the finish. Prevent utilizing abrasive cleaners or extreme chemicals, as these can damage the surface area.
